The three medical house sharers, who rented a house from Harry Cross, were Sandra (Scottish and proud owner of aforementioned Miss Selfridge lipstick kiss dressing gown), Kate and Pat. Pat was a porter, the other two were nurses. Kate got killed in the siege. It was very exciting.

Harry and Edna (afterwards, Ralph) lived in the bungalow, which they bought from Slan Partridge (not that one) for £21k after Alan split up with his girlfriend Sam.

Sandra’s friend Jackie did saucy kissograms in a nurse’s uniform, with Pat driving her around in an ambulance, to Sandra’s fury.

Pat left the close after insinuating himself into an all-female band by copping off with the keyboard player then hijacking the microphone during a gig watched by an A&R man, who picked him and the guitarist over Pat’s girlfriend and the singer. Bad Pat!
